Overview of Trap musician Kilo Jugg
With his distinctive style and sound, Kilo Jugg, a Hip Hop and Trap musician from London, United Kingdom, has established himself in the music business. Kilo Jugg has established himself as a significant presence in the UK music scene over the course of a long career that has included numerous releases.
The words in Kilo Jugg's songs are unvarnished and gritty, and they are accompanied by powerful beats and captivating melodies. His music combines classic Hip Hop with modern Trap, with influences from other genres like Grime and Drill. Kilo Jugg's music reflects his experiences in life and the world around him, and his sincerity and genuineness are evident in it.

What are the latest songs and music albums for Trap musician Kilo Jugg?
With the release of his most recent album, "Destiny: Vol. 1," in 2019, London, United Kingdom's Kilo Jugg has been making waves in the rap scene. The album has a variety of songs that reflect his love of Hip Hop and Trap music. Kilo Jugg's sound has been characterized as raw and dynamic, with a special fusion of beats and vocals that entice listeners to return for more.
Kilo Jugg has released a number of tunes that have been increasingly popular in the rap world since the release of his album. He recently released the tracks "Delirious," "Otto Octavius," "Numbers Don't," and "Drink." Kilo Jugg's versatility as an artist is demonstrated by each track, which each has a distinctive sound and mood of its own.

Which are the most important collaborations with other musicians for Trap musician Kilo Jugg?
Rising talent in the UK's Hip Hop and Trap scene Kilo Jugg has worked with a variety of other musicians. The song "Mad About Bars - S5-E31" with Kenny Allstar, "Numbers Don't" with Groundworks, "Happy Slap" again with Groundworks, and "Fed Up" with Yung Fume are just a few of his most prominent collaborations.
